* loop-unswitch.c (unswitch_loop): Remove local variable src.
authorKazu Hirata <kazu@cs.umass.edu>
Mon, 7 Mar 2005 15:17:21 +0000 (15:17 +0000)
committerKazu Hirata <kazu@gcc.gnu.org>
Mon, 7 Mar 2005 15:17:21 +0000 (15:17 +0000)
From-SVN: r96026

gcc/ChangeLog
gcc/loop-unswitch.c

index 5cc9c7e77e1427bc64dadcc605c180915d7a6c89..986b1da9e1a903fcc37403240956ed7f79e75f99 100644 (file)
@@ -38,6 +38,8 @@
        * cfgrtl.c (rtl_verify_flow_info_1): Remove local variable
        last_bb_seen.
 
+       * loop-unswitch.c (unswitch_loop): Remove local variable src.
+
 2005-03-07  David Billinghurst <David.Billinghurst@riotinto.com>
 
        * config/i386/cygwin1.c(mingw_scan): Use xstrdup in calls to putenv.
index f307dc1a2996cf109b99cd66ed4aec29a8647291..9b6262011a57d1bb024fccb28da9797def1edfa1 100644 (file)
@@ -406,7 +406,7 @@ unswitch_loop (struct loops *loops, struct loop *loop, basic_block unswitch_on,
               rtx cond, rtx cinsn)
 {
   edge entry, latch_edge, true_edge, false_edge, e;
-  basic_block switch_bb, unswitch_on_alt, src;
+  basic_block switch_bb, unswitch_on_alt;
   struct loop *nloop;
   sbitmap zero_bitmap;
   int irred_flag, prob;
@@ -429,7 +429,6 @@ unswitch_loop (struct loops *loops, struct loop *loop, basic_block unswitch_on,
   entry = loop_preheader_edge (loop);
 
   /* Make a copy.  */
-  src = entry->src;
   irred_flag = entry->flags & EDGE_IRREDUCIBLE_LOOP;
   entry->flags &= ~EDGE_IRREDUCIBLE_LOOP;
   zero_bitmap = sbitmap_alloc (2);